Abstract

This Research project aims to address a prevalent issue of identifying any fabricated information being shared online to curb the widespread of any false information being shared online. To achieve this, a robust fake news classification application is developed using flask framework with an underlying advanced Machine learning model such as Hybrid Ensemble Classifier to analyse the textual news data and distinguish them as genuine or fake. A Docker image is created for this application along with its dependencies such as Flask, packed in the required format for improving scalability and simplifying deployment across various platforms for ease of access. The Application is tested with high concurrency loads generated by Locust and to combat any performance issues for dynamically scaling the computational resources based on demand. For this reason, it is essential that the metrics are collected and studied in detail. This project utilizes AWS CloudWatch and Azure Monitor cloud tools to collect different metrics of the application under study to organize a performance evaluation between AWS and Microsoft Azure to assess the application’s efficiency. This comparison is essential in aiding the decision that would have to be taken when choosing wither of these cloud platforms for a Dockerized application deployment of similar magnitude.
